Decided to upload some pictures of a target stand I came up with a year or two ago. It's made from pre cut Lowes rebar and turnbuckles. It completely breaks down and will fit in a tiny trunk. Thus far it has taken hundreds of rounds of 300 win mag as close as 200 without issue on hard and soft surfaces. It has only minor wear from shrapnel as well.

Assembly starts with the third picture. As long as you have the turnbuckles and rebar like this it will be very stable with all the tension holding up the top bar.
